Y OF TIMER 15MS */= 0CH ; /* SET PARAM */TIME (100); = 0CH; TIME (30); = 08H; I = 1 TO 10; TIME (100);; = 20H; I = 1 TO 10; TIME (100);; = 20H; I = 1 TO 10; TIME (100);; = 04H; TIME (40); = 18H; INIT_GKI; _01 PROCEDURE; GKI (90H, 94H); = ADR_READ; STATUS_01 ; _02 PROCEDURE; I BYTE; GKI (90H, 94H); I = ADR_READ_FROM TO ADR_READ_TO; = ADR_READ; _READ = ADR_READ +1;; STATUS_02; _03 PROCEDURE; GKI (95H, 98H); _WRITE = V_WRITE; STATUS_03; _04 PROCEDURE ; I BYTE; GKI (95H, 98H); I = ADR_WRITE_FROM TO ADR_WRITE_TO; _WRITE = V_WRITE; _WRITE = ADR_WRITE +1;; STATUS_03; _PROG: DO; STATUS BYTE PUBLIC; V_TMOD BYTE AT (89H) MAIN PUBLIC; V_TCON BYTE AT (88H) MAIN PUBLIC; V_TH0 BYTE AT (8CH) MAIN PUBLIC; V_TL0 BYTE AT (8AH) MAIN PUBLIC; V_TH1 BYTE AT (8DH) MAIN PUBLIC; V_TL1 BYTE AT (8BH) MAIN PUBLIC; ADR_READ BYTE PUBLIC; ADR_WRITE BYTE PUBLIC; ADR_READ_FROM BYTE PUBLIC; ADR_READ_TO BYTE PUBLIC; ADR_WRITE_FROM BYTE PUBLIC; ADR_WRITE_TO BYTE PUBLIC; V_WRITE BYTE PUBLIC; MSG (9) BYTE AT (90H) WHILE STATUS <10H; STATUS = 00H THEN CALL STATUS_00; STATUS = 01H THEN CALL STATUS_01; STATUS = 02H THEN CALL STATUS_02; STATUS = 03H THEN CALL STATUS_03; CHECK_STATUS; MAIN_PROG;
Додаток В Таблиця символьної кодування
В
Додаток З Принципова схема пристрою
В